    Introduction to Astronomy

    Unit 1: What is Astronomy?

    scientific study of celestial objects and phenomena

    Scientific study of celestial objects and phenomena.

    Astronomy is a fascinating field of study that has captivated humanity's curiosity for thousands of years. But what exactly is astronomy? Simply put, astronomy is the scientific study of celestial objects, space, and the physical universe as a whole. It is a branch of science that seeks to explain everything that occurs outside of Earth's atmosphere.

    The Scope of Astronomy

    Astronomy is a vast field that covers a wide range of topics. It includes the study of objects we can see with the naked eye, like stars and planets, as well as phenomena that require advanced technology to observe, such as black holes and distant galaxies.

    Astronomers study the composition and behavior of celestial bodies, the physics of the universe, and the origins and evolution of stars, galaxies, and the universe itself. They also seek to understand phenomena such as supernovae, gamma-ray bursts, quasars, and cosmic microwave background radiation.

    The Tools of Astronomy

    Astronomers use a variety of tools to observe the universe. The most familiar of these is probably the telescope. Telescopes collect more light than the human eye can, allowing us to see faint and distant objects. There are many types of telescopes, including optical telescopes that collect visible light, radio telescopes that detect radio waves, and space telescopes like the Hubble Space Telescope that observe the universe from above Earth's atmosphere.

    In addition to telescopes, astronomers use instruments like spectrometers to analyze the light from celestial objects and determine their composition, temperature, and velocity. They also use computers to simulate celestial phenomena and analyze large amounts of data.

    The Role of Astronomy

    Astronomy plays a crucial role in our understanding of the universe and our place in it. It helps us answer fundamental questions about the nature of the universe and the laws that govern it. It also has practical applications, such as in the development of calendars and navigation systems.

    Moreover, astronomy inspires us to look beyond our own planet and consider the broader universe. It reminds us of the vastness of space and the wonder of the cosmos. It encourages us to ask big questions and seek out the answers.

    In conclusion, astronomy is a fascinating and wide-ranging field of study that uses scientific methods to explore the universe. It encompasses everything from the study of planets and stars to the investigation of the fundamental laws of physics. Whether you're interested in the details of celestial bodies or the broader questions of how and why the universe exists, astronomy has something to offer.
